			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The Group has been contacted by <strong>Dawn Cole</strong>, a PhD student at Manchester University<strong>, </strong>to see if any local residents can help out with some research she is undertaking. The aim of her study is to improve understanding of how individuals and households make decisions about where to live. It will look how people form an overall impression of a local area, at the qualities which are attractive in a neighbourhood and how trade-offs are made between competing qualities. The project will also investigate how different people within a household come to agree on a place to live, looking at, for example who takes the lead in making the decision and at any compromises that are made.</p>
<p>Dawn would like to make contact with a cross-section of Chorlton residents, present, past and those looking to move into the area.</p>
<p>It only takes an hour of your time. Dawn interviews you in a very relaxed, conversational style to find out what your views are of the local area and records it for her study. No pressure. No right or wrong answers. Just your story, circumstances and opinions.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Between Christmas and New Year, one of our friends on the Arrowfield estate, a 74-year-old lady, was the victim of a brutal knife attack in broad daylight as she waited at the bus stop on Arrowfield Road. She was seriously injured and required a number of days&#8217; hospital treatment. She&#8217;s now back at home and is recovering.</p>
<p>The perpetrator has been caught and has pleaded guilty to the attack, so that&#8217;s a relief for our friend and the community in general.</p>
<p>At the weekend, members of the group went round to visit the victim and presented her with a bunch of flowers and the best wishes of the Group and the neighbourhood. We are pleased to report that, despite her ordeal and injuries, she is in fantastic spirits and is well on the road to recovery.</p>
<p>We wish her all the best for a full and speedy recovery, and hope to see her at one of our forthcoming events.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Thursday 17th November saw the Group&#8217;s Annual General Meeting take place at Buckthorn House. Local residents were joined by a range of guests including members of Southway Housing&#8217;s team, local police officers, Action for Sustainable Living, councillors Ian Hyde, Norman Lewis and Bernie Ryan and MP John Leech.</p>
<p>A resumé of the year&#8217;s activities was presented by Chairman Richard Miller and a financial statement was provided by Treasurer Amina Kasar. Presentations were given by Southway&#8217;s Steve Fanning about proposed environmental improvements and by Simon Robinson of Action for Sustainable Living about the <a title="Get Switched On – Become An Energy Champion" href="http://arrowfieldhoughend.org.uk/agm/get-switched-on-become-an-energy-champion" target="_blank">Energy Academy</a> initiative they are launching in the area.</p>
<p>Attendees were given the opportunity to discuss local issues to the agency representatives present resulting in debates about improving aspects of the local environment, crime and security, parking and rubbish collection.</p>
<p>As part of the  Group&#8217;s constitution and this being the AGM, a new committee was formed and new officers elected. Voted into the key roles were Bob Stacey, who is the new Chairman; Richard Miller (who has been Chairman for the past 20 months) – Secretary; and Amina Kasar who resumes her role as Treasurer for the second consecutive year. We also welcome Samantha Thompson onto the committee, and offer an ongoing invitation to all local residents who may wish to join the committee and get more closely involved in helping out with the Group and its activities.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Thursday 3rd November saw the Arrowfield and Hough End Community Action Group stage the first &#8216;Seniors&#8217; Cinema&#8217; event, specifically aimed at the older members of our community.</p>
<p>This was kindly hosted by Chorlton High School at the Blue Box Theatre, with funding provided by Southway Housing. Around 20 cinema-goers enjoyed a special screening of the Bafta and Academy Award-winning &#8220;The King&#8217;s Speech&#8221; starring Colin Firth as King George VI and Geoffrey Rush as the therapist who helps him overcome his debilitating speech impediment.</p>
<p>The screening was preceded by a buffet meal of soup, sandwiches, cakes, tea and coffee, all served up by Chorlton High School student Anna Markman.</p>
<p>We would hopefully like to make this a regular event, so if there&#8217;s film you&#8217;d like to see on the big screen, then get in touch with your suggestions.</p>
<p>The group would like to extend special thanks to the staff and students of Chorlton High School, especially Diane Clavin for helping make this event such a success.</p>
